Type of Bond

A right-of-way permit bond is a type of surety bond that is required by government agencies or municipalities to ensure that a contractor or individual will comply with the terms and conditions of a right-of-way permit. A right-of-way permit grants someone the legal authority to access and use a specific area of public property, such as a road, sidewalk, or utility easement, for a particular purpose, such as construction or maintenance work. The purpose of a right-of-way permit bond is to protect the interests of the government agency or municipality that issues the permit, as well as the public. It provides a financial guarantee that the permit holder will adhere to the regulations, complete the permitted work within the specified timeframe, and restore the right-of-way to its original condition after the work is completed. If the permit holder fails to fulfill their obligations or causes damage to the right-of-way, the bond can be used to compensate the government agency or municipality for any resulting costs or losses. This ensures that the public's rights and interests are protected and that any necessary repairs or restoration can be carried out promptly. In summary, a right-of-way permit bond is a type of surety bond that serves as a financial guarantee for a permit holder's compliance with the terms and conditions of a right-of-way permit, while safeguarding the government agency or municipality and the public from potential financial losses or damages.
